Andersen Returns to Net Amidst Losing Streak

Goalie Frederik Andersen is slated to start between the pipes for the home game against the Rangers on Wednesday. Andersen has been struggling recently, marked by a four-game losing streak where he has posted a .854 save percentage, conceding 13 goals on 89 shots. While he has alternated starts during this difficult period, Andersen appears poised for a greater workload due to the absence of Pyotr Kochetkov, who is sidelined with a lower-body injury.

The opposing Rangers have also faced offensive challenges, scoring only 12 goals in their last six contests, resulting in a 2-4-0 record. This could present a favorable matchup for Andersen to break his streak and find his rhythm. His performance will be crucial as his team navigates Kochetkov's absence.
